Ok, I'll bite. How exactly did France cheat in the 98 World Cup?
They manipulated the group draws to ensure all the big countries were in the other side of the bracket. It’s not a secret. ESPN did an article last year or the year before. It’s why the draws are now done live with the names in sealed containers.
